I am using the LK 8000 Beta! Just yesterday i found out that i no longer can get OLC information. I have a bottombar in AUX to show all OLC data.
I have marked ON in menu 22 contest -OLC on.

As it is for now i cannot see any OLC data in the bottombar. And i cant see OLC distance in the logbook under details. I used to be able to see that.
Another issue is: When i have landed after a task i usually just EXIT out of LK 8000. Is there a method to stop more correct?

I think OLC calculation is turned off for your logbook, because was not working correctly anyways.. My experience with this is the values are allways off a few km compared to what OLC was showing
Beside that, who is using OLC these days, most have turned to Weglide.

What I do is upload my flight to Weglide immediately after I landed and then I know the distance I have flown. One of the advantages of flying with your phone.

Wait for the airport dingdong indicating LK8000 has 'landed' and closed your flight, before turning off LK8000, takes a minute or so. This also makes sure the IGC file is valid.
